Hello,
Does anyone know how to access the log files of the router please? I'd like to find out what devices have connected to my network.

It's not hard to find. It's labelled "System Log" under Status. It only appears to show the last 24 hours or so on mine. You could also look at Network Device Table, also under Status to see devices that have connected recently.

On a side note, applying mac filtering would allow you to limit what devices to connect to the wifi.
Worked great when I had a few devices. Now with over a dozen, I gave up.
